Blackshirt316 Posted November 24, 2008 Share Posted November 24, 2008 Those rankings aren't even realistc. Feldman has Georgia Tech vs. West Virginia in the Gator Bowl, but than has California vs. Notre Dame in the Sun bowl. This is impossible if the Gator chooses a B12 team the Sun bowl does not, but if the Gator bowl does NOT select a B12 team the Sun bowl MUST select a B12 team. He apparently doesn't even have Kansas going to a bowl even though they have to be invited based on bowl tie ins. Kansas is a virtual lock for the Insight Bowl, there is almost no chance Nebraska goes to the Insight Bowl. If we lose to Colorado we'd still be selected ahead of Kansas and Colorado which means we would still not go to the Insight bowl. Schlaubach is a bit more realistic, but there's almost no way that the Gator bowl takes Missouri over Nebraska. The only school that had a shot at that was Notre Dame and the lost to Syracuse. The Gator bowl is in dire straits right now and absolutely NEEDS a big name team that travels well. Missouri is not that team. Quote Link to comment
